He pointed out, in a statement, that “the decisions of the Minister of Agriculture and the Prime Minister to bring in 6,000 tons of potatoes from Egypt, outside the period permitted for importing from Egypt, hit Akkar’s potato production, and the price of a kilogram became sold for less than 0.20 dollars and cost more than 0.” ,35 dollars and exposed hundreds of farmers and thousands of workers in the agricultural sector to bankruptcy at a time when food security in Lebanon needs these farmers to feed the Lebanese people and secure the basic food basket.
Howayek pointed out, “The disasters that befell the spring and summer production of fruit trees, which hit production due to cold and snow, inflicting losses on farmers that they cannot afford.”
And he considered, what was issued by the Ministry of Agriculture and the Higher Relief Commission regarding the disclosure of the damages to compensate for them, “a populist, absurd lie that we are accustomed to from irresponsible officials, and it confirms the amount of deception that surrounds the Lebanese in general and farmers in particular.”
